Output 03cce6dda18a9aa82c4ca76498c8177a6ff02ef47b5b51ff152dbb9f7909125d:1

value
2458961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fca958b9b79c59bcb3d03c32da42db4ec06f6aa OP_EQUAL
address
3Bt7cdZjMNz3LkZuvY6CuEoE6TvNik38eX
transaction
03cce6dda18a9aa82c4ca76498c8177a6ff02ef47b5b51ff152dbb9f7909125d
confirmations
342872
spent
true